1.
FLASHCARD QUESTION
Front
What is kinetic energy?
Back
Kinetic energy is the energy that an object possesses due to its motion, calculated using the formula KE = 1/2 mv², where m is mass and v is velocity.

2.
FLASHCARD QUESTION
Front
What is potential energy?
Back
Potential energy is the stored energy of an object due to its position or state, such as gravitational potential energy, which depends on height and mass.

3.
FLASHCARD QUESTION
Front
At which point is kinetic energy greatest in a roller coaster ride?
Back
Kinetic energy is greatest at the lowest point of the roller coaster, where the speed is highest.

5.
FLASHCARD QUESTION
Front
How does velocity affect kinetic energy?
Back
Kinetic energy increases with the square of the velocity; if velocity doubles, kinetic energy increases by a factor of four.

6.
FLASHCARD QUESTION
Front
What is the relationship between mass and kinetic energy?
Back
Kinetic energy is directly proportional to mass; if mass increases, kinetic energy increases, assuming velocity remains constant.
